Mobile mapping studies have actually come to be a core solution at LandScope Design, transforming the way in which we gauge, map, think of, and analyse environments. While mobile mapping" is a more general term for the technical developments that have actually changed the mapping industry, a mobile mapping study refers to the real procedure of accumulating mobile mapping information that can later on be utilized for civil design, ecological preservation, or any variety of various other objectives.

The applications of mobile mapping are not industry-specific, and they include mapping streets, trains, streams, coastal geographic features, piers, buildings, and various other above-ground and underwater energies. With mobile mapping systems, terabytes of high resolution and accuracy information can be collected promptly. The limitations of mobile mapping consist of budgetary concerns, false impressions regarding accuracy, roi, and the high quality of deliverables. The accuracy of the data depends partly on the mobile mapping system being made use of.

The leading mobile mapping systems include the Leica Pegasus, the Trimble MX50, the Lynx H2600, the Reigl VMY-2, and the Mosaic Viking. This modern technology has many applications in company framework monitoring, military and highway, highway and defense mapping, metropolitan planning, ecological surveillance, and various other sectors, also.
